Anna King
Anna is the Deputy CEO at Habitats & Heritage, where she leads the development of the Grimwood Road Community Garden in Twickenham – a welcoming space that brings people together through nature, learning and community action. With a background in social work, Anna has spent her career supporting children, families, including those caring for children with disabilities. She was privileged to spend ten years leading the Holly Lodge Centre in Richmond Park, helping children and people with disabilities discover and enjoy the nature and heritage of one of London’s most treasured landscapes. Passionate about making the outdoors accessible to everyone, Anna loves creating opportunities for people to connect with nature. She has a particular affection for the River Thames and, when she’s not at work, can often be found kayaking from Richmond Canoe Club and exploring the river’s ever-changing wildlife and landscapes.
